Udostępnij za pośrednictwem


DataReaderEventData Konstruktor

Definicja

DiagnosticSource Tworzy ładunek zdarzenia dla .DataReaderClosing

public DataReaderEventData(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bCommand command, System.Data.Common.DbDataReader dataReader, Microsoft.EntityFrameworkCore.DbContext? context, Guid commandId, Guid connectionId, int recordsAffected, int readCount, DateTimeOffset startTime);
new Microsoft.EntityFrameworkCore.Diagnostics.DataReaderEventData :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ase *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ase, Microsoft.EntityFrameworkCore.Diagnostics.EventData, string> * System.Data.Common.DbCommand * System.Data.Common.DbDataReader * Microsoft.EntityFrameworkCore.DbContext * Guid * Guid * int * int * DateTimeOffset -> Microsoft.EntityFrameworkCore.Diagnostics.DataReaderEventData
Public Sub New (eventDefinition As EventDefinitionBase, messageGenerator As Func(Of EventDefinitionBase, EventData, String), command As DbCommand, dataReader As DbDataReader, context As DbContext, commandId As Guid, connectionId As Guid, recordsAffected As Integer, readCount As Integer, startTime As DateTimeOffset)

Parametry

eventDefinition
EventDefinitionBase

Definicja zdarzenia.

messageGenerator
Func<EventDefinitionBase,EventData,String>

Delegat, który generuje komunikat dziennika dla tego zdarzenia.

command
DbCommand

Element DbCommand , który utworzył czytnik.

dataReader
DbDataReader

Jest DbDataReader on usuwany.

context
DbContext

Aktualnie DbContext używane do wartości null, jeśli nie są znane.

commandId
Guid

Identyfikator korelacji, który identyfikuje DbCommand używane wystąpienie.

connectionId
Guid

Identyfikator korelacji, który identyfikuje DbConnection używane wystąpienie.

recordsAffected
Int32

Pobiera liczbę wierszy zmienionych, wstawionych lub usuniętych przez wykonanie instrukcji SQL.

readCount
Int32

Pobiera liczbę operacji odczytu wykonywanych przez tego czytnika.

startTime
DateTimeOffset

Godzina rozpoczęcia tego zdarzenia.

Dotyczy